RHEST (Regional Homeless Engagement with Substance Treatment)

020 3745 0363, https://www.phoenix-futures.org.uk/phoenix-futures-for/people-and-families-who-use-our-services/find-a-service/rhest-london-regional-homeless-engagement-with-substance-use-treatment-team/
This service is aimed at improving access to drug and alcohol treatment for people who sleep rough or are housed in a hostel or other temporary accommodation. The RhEST team at Phoenix Futures assertively engages with referrals through outreach and in-reach. It operates across all London boroughs. It delivers time-limited interventions that improve access to services. It will assess barriers to drug and alcohol treatment for each individual and collaborates with a range of agencies to improve outcomes. You can make a self-referral if you are experiencing homelessness, are over 18 and you are willing to engage with the service. Referral form: https://tinyurl.com/4kf52zrz CODES: A, S, MS, OW, DW

St Luke's Service - Barking & Dagenham (CGL)

St Lukes, Dagenham Road RM10 7UP
020 8595 1375, http://bit.ly/2sveUVH
Monday: 10am-12am (appointments 5–7pm); Tuesday & Friday: 2pm-4pm; Thursday: 5pm-7pm (appointments); Drop in or phone, or refer yourself at stlukes@cgl.org.uk. Treatment options to support you include: One-to-one support sessions with a recovery worker; Group work; Peer support; Personalised treatment plan; Advice on keeping safe; Medication assisted treatment, including Buvidal; Testing for blood-borne viruses such as hepatitis C and B, and HIV; Emotional support and counselling; Onward referrals to a range of specialist services Criminal justice support services; Access to different detox and rehab options; Education, training and employment advice.
